
The Parkside Primary School where Air-stream meetings are held each month is now connected into the Air-Stream network via Julia Farr.
Future meetings may include live streaming over wireless allowing members to particpate including, IRC, and even VoIP.
Details on connection and viewing time will be posted on the events pages as they become available.
